District 7 encompasses 40 square miles of unincorporated Palm Beach County west of the City of Boca Raton. We have a direct service population in excess of 103,000 citizens. Our fine team of professionals works closely to provide the West Boca Raton community with the finest in public service.
Citizen involvement, preventing crimes of opportunity, traffic enforcement and general crime prevention education are just a few of the District 7 initiatives. We consistently work with the community through our County Commission, the West Boca Community Council, our Security and Business Liaison Group, local schools and the many home owner associations to maintain the high quality of life in West Boca Raton.
District 7 is staffed with ninety-four (94) Sworn Law Enforcement Officers and seventeen (17) Civilian Support Staff.
The District 7 office is located at 17901 U.S. Highway 441 Boca Raton, FL (Click here for a map), operating in conjunction with two neighborhood policing centers, one located in Boca Del Mar and the other on the campus of the Jewish Community Center.
